Description |
A stage dramatisation by Heather Lindsay of "Letters From A Fainthearted Feminist" by Jill Tweedie which was first published as a column in the British newspaper The Guardian. In this solo performance, a married housewife and mother of two teenagers and a young baby longs to put into practice the precepts of the women's movement but she is thwarted at every turn... |
